Forum Programmation.SQL calcul de moyennes dans postgreSQL

Posté par  . Licence CC By‑SA.
Étiquettes :
0
14
fév.
2020

Bonjour,

Dans une base pg, j'ai une table "data" qui ressemble à celle ci (ma vrai table a bien plus de "code" et d'années) :

code date_debut valeur
1 2015-01-01 6.5
1 2016-01-01 8.1
1 2017-01-01 2.1
1 2018-01-01 9.0
1 2019-01-01 10.0
2 2015-01-01 3.0
2 2016-01-01 1.7
2 2017-01-01 4.0
2 2018-01-01 1.2
2 2019-01-01 8.3
3 2015-01-01 5.3
3 2016-01-01 9.9
3 2017-01-01 3.7
3 2018-01-01 8.1
3 2019-01-01 8.6

j'aimerais calculer pour chaque "code", les moyennes (…)

Meilleures contributions LinuxFr.org : les primées de janvier 2020

Posté par  (site web personnel, Mastodon) . Édité par Davy Defaud, ZeroHeure et Benoît Sibaud. Modéré par Pierre Jarillon.
Étiquettes :
12
7
fév.
2020
LinuxFr.org

Nous continuons sur notre lancée de récompenser celles et ceux qui chaque mois contribuent au site LinuxFr.org (dépêches, commentaires, logo, journaux, correctifs, etc.). Vous n’êtes pas sans risquer de gagner un livre des éditions Eyrolles ou ENI. Voici les gagnants du mois de janvier 2020 :

Les livres gagnés sont détaillés en seconde partie de la dépêche. N’oubliez pas de contribuer, LinuxFr.org vit pour vous et par vous !

Sortie de Crème CRM en version 2.1

Posté par  (site web personnel) . Édité par Ysabeau 🧶 🧦, Davy Defaud, ZeroHeure et patrick_g. Modéré par patrick_g. Licence CC By‑SA.
18
4
fév.
2020
Commercial

Le 6 janvier 2020 est sortie la version 2.1 du logiciel de gestion de la relation client Crème CRM (sous licence AGPL-3.0). La précédente version étant la 2.0 (sortie le 11 janvier 2019).

Icone de Crème CRM

Au programme notamment, le passage à Django 2.2. Les nouveautés sont détaillées dans la suite de la dépêche.

Forum général.petites-annonces [CDD 9 mois] Ingénieur en ingénierie logicielle JavaEE GWT H/F

Posté par  . Licence CC By‑SA.
4
30
jan.
2020

Le réseau national d'observatoires de la phénologie TEMPO recrute à Avignon un ou une ingénieur en ingénierie logicielle JavaEE GWT pour le développement de son système d'information de données phénologiques.

Contexte & cadre de travail

Le projet de système d'information du réseau national TEMPO développé à l'unité de service INRAE AgroClim a pour ambition de rendre accessible les données phénologiques à l'ensemble des personnes intéressées via une interface web.

Vous serez accueilli(e) au sein de l'unité de service AgroClim à (…)

Requêtes et jointures avec pgModeler (PostgreSQL)

Posté par  . Édité par BAud, Davy Defaud, Ysabeau 🧶 🧦, Benoît Sibaud, claudex et ZeroHeure. Modéré par claudex. Licence CC By‑SA.
64
29
jan.
2020
Base de données

Bon, voilà, j’ai développé ce greffon pour pgModeler (C++/Qt), et j’ai envie de le partager dans une petite dépêche.

Mes motivations principales étaient de pouvoir effectuer des requêtes dans mon logiciel de modélisation préféré, bien entendu, et le fait que les logiciels de modélisation que je connais ne prennent pas en charge les jointures existantes ou automatiques.

Votre client SQL est cool ? Mais est‑il cool à ce point ?! :)

Rapide présentation de pgModeler

pgModeler est un logiciel de modélisation de base de données. Bien que plutôt généraliste — si l’on s’en tient à un modèle logique des données — il est spécialisé PostgreSQL. Il permet entre autres de :

  • construire par interface graphique un modèle de base de données (tables, schémas, rôles…), mais bien plus ; en fait, il propose toutes les fonctionnalités offertes par PostgreSQL, allant jusqu’aux extensions PostGIS ;
  • créer une base de données à partir d’un modèle : passer de la représentation à l’implémentation ;
  • à l’inverse, créer un modèle à partir d’une base de données ;
  • comparer une instance PostgreSQL avec un modèle et produire — voire réintégrer — les différences entre schémas ;
  • administrer sa base, avec un module riche, mais qui n’égalera sans doute pas pgAdmin ;
  • produire un dictionnaire des données.

Des discussions sont en cours pour rendre pgModeler nativement compatible avec les autres systèmes de gestion de bases de données relationnelles (SGBDR) grâce à l’excellent extracto‑chargeur (ETL) pgLoader.

Forum général.petites-annonces [POURVUE] GRAP recrute un·e technicien·ne informatique, assistance et support - F/H

Posté par  (site web personnel) . Licence CC By‑SA.
6
28
jan.
2020

Bonjour,
Je me permets de partager cette offre d'emploi en espérant que ça soit le bon endroit :)

Contexte

La coopérative GRAP (Groupement Régional Alimentaire de Proximité) est un g*roupe coopératif d’entrepreneur·se·s, qui propose des services support mutualisés (comptabilité, informatique de gestion, financement, accompagnement métier, paie etc.) aux acteurs rhônalpins de la filière **alimentaire biologique & locale* (épiceries bio, restaurants, boulangeries, etc.). GRAP utilise en particulier le statut de Coopérative d’Activités et d’Emploi (CAE) pour héberger entrepreneur·se·s (…)

Journal GoatCounter 1.0 un Web analytique léger, libre et respectueux

Posté par  (site web personnel) . Licence CC By‑SA.
Étiquettes :
20
18
jan.
2020

GoatCounter est un outil de statistiques Web avancées. La plupart des gens ou des entreprises n’ont pas besoin des monstres plus connus Google Analytics et son pendant libre Matomo (et tous les autres) qui sont difficiles à maîtriser, en plus d’avoir d’autres défauts : ils alourdissent les pages et collectent bien trop d’informations sur les visiteurs.
Goatcounter est facile à installer, une offre hébergée à prix accessible existe, il ajoute moins de 2 Kio à la page, il utilise SQLite (…)

Forum Linux.debian/ubuntu [Résolu] : Déploiement du projet Webmail Sogo

Posté par  . Licence CC By‑SA.
Étiquettes :
0
16
jan.
2020

Bonjour à tous,

Dans un premier temps, j'ai déployé un serveur IMAP dovecot et un serveur SMTP Opensmtp.

J'ai testé l'IMAP et le SMTP avec le client léger claws mail qui a l'avantage de tracer les connexions IMAP/SMTP pour les emails.

SOLUTION : Il fallait à priori passer à la version de sogo 4.1.1 au minimum pour régler le problème de connexion IMAP avec dovecot.

Dovecot a comme base les users linux avec une ACL.

OpenSMTP authentifie les users par (…)

Interview de Xavier Mouton‑Dubosc, animateur à la radio FMR

21
1
déc.
2019
Audiovisuel

Xavier Mouton‑Dubosc est plus connu ici sous le nom de Da Scritch. Il présente régulièrement sur LinuxFr.org le programme de CPU de Radio FMR, où il officie depuis 1993. CPU pour « Carré, Petit, Utile » se définit comme le programme radio des gens du Numérique.

Logo CPU Carré, Petit, Utile : Le programme radio des gens du numérique. Tous les jeudis à 11 h sur Radio « FMR »  
 

Radio « FMR » est une radio associative toulousaine créée en 1981 par de bonnes fées punks situationnistes proposant une antenne variée qui fait, à juste titre, la fierté de l’ensemble de ses animateurs et animatrices.

Agenda du Libre pour la semaine 48 de l’année 2019

Posté par  . Édité par Benoît Sibaud, Davy Defaud et Florent Zara. Modéré par Benoît Sibaud. Licence CC By‑SA.
10
24
nov.
2019
Communauté

Calendrier Web, regroupant des événements liés au Libre (logiciel, salon, atelier, install party, conférence), annoncés par leurs organisateurs. Voici un récapitulatif de la semaine à venir. Le détail de chacun de ces cinquante-six événements (France : 51, Québec : 3, Belgique : 2) est en seconde partie de dépêche.

Agenda du Libre pour la semaine 47 de l’année 2019

Posté par  . Édité par Benoît Sibaud, claudex et Davy Defaud. Modéré par Benoît Sibaud. Licence CC By‑SA.
11
17
nov.
2019
Communauté

Calendrier Web, regroupant des événements liés au Libre (logiciel, salon, atelier, install party, conférence), annoncés par leurs organisateurs. Voici un récapitulatif de la semaine à venir. Le détail de chacun de ces cinquante‐sept événements (France : 51, Québec : 3, Belgique : 2, Suisse : 1) est en seconde partie de dépêche.

Revue de presse — novembre 2019

20
14
nov.
2019
Presse

Novembre, mois impair rime avec renouvellement des bimestriels. Vous pouvez dès à présent refaire le plein de lecture chez votre kiosque de journaux préféré. Petit tour subjectif et parti{e,a}l de la presse papier, celle que vous pouvez encore trouver, en novembre 2019, chez votre marchand de journaux.

Les nouveautés de ce mois‑ci :

  • GNU/Linux Magazine France no 231 crée sa première blockchain ;
  • Linux Pratique no 116 troque OpenVPN pour WireGuard ;
  • MISC magazine no 106 éprouve la sécurité des applications mobiles ;
  • GNU/Linux Magazine hors‑série no 105 cède à la folie DevOps ;
  • et un Linux Référence hors‑série no 3 spécial apprentissage du Python.

Toujours présents :

  • Linux Pratique hors‑série no 46 sécurise votre poste de travail ;
  • MISC hors‑série no 20 s’attaque aux Active Directory Windows ;
  • Planète Linux no 111 fait dans la nostalgie des anciens articles ;
  • Hackable no 31 rend artificiellement intelligent votre Arduino ;
  • Virus Informatique no 41, qui en remet une couche sur Qwant ;
  • ainsi que Linux Inside no 47, bardé de tutoriels et comparatifs, et aussi Linux Référence no 3, sur le jeu sous GNU/Linux.

N. D. L. A. : La revue de presse est ouverte pour parler de vos magazines. Elle est en gestation dans l’espace de rédaction et est publiée quand elle est assez dense et pas trop en retard.

Journal Sortie de Glewlwyd 2.0, serveur SSO

Posté par  (site web personnel) . Licence CC By‑SA.
14
3
nov.
2019

Glewlwyd, serveur SSO polyvalent, est maintenant disponible en version 2.0 sur les interwebs!

https://babelouest.github.io/glewlwyd/

Je reprends une partie de l'ancien journal écrit pour la sortie de la RC2, mais celui-ci est bien plus détaillé pour les curieux.

Installer

Paquets pour certaines distributions

Des paquets pour certaines distributions Linux sont disponibles ici: https://github.com/babelouest/glewlwyd/releases/tag/v2.0.0

Image Docker

Une image Docker est disponible ici pour tester rapidement, ou pour utiliser en vrai, juste en modifiant une option: https://hub.docker.com/r/babelouest/

Installation manuelle avec CMake

Sinon le (…)

La version 0.6 de Libreosteo est sortie

Posté par  . Édité par ZeroHeure, Davy Defaud, palm123, Julien Jorge, Benoît Sibaud, Pierre Jarillon et Florent Zara. Modéré par Florent Zara. Licence CC By‑SA.
21
31
oct.
2019
Médecine

Libreosteo est une application Web, libre, multi‐plate‐forme, pour les ostéopathes. Cet outil a pour vocation d’accompagner l’ostéopathe dans la gestion de son cabinet : le suivi des patients, la facturation et la comptabilité.

Il est installé principalement en local (en général sous Windows ou macOS), permettant ainsi de l’utiliser sans connexion Internet. D’autres ostéopathes l’installent sur des serveurs sous GNU/Linux ou via une image Docker, permettant ainsi d’y accéder depuis n’importe quel point d’accès à ces serveurs.

La version 0.6 est sortie le 23 octobre 2019. La dernière version stable (0.5.7) était sortie le 7 juin 2017.

Capture d’écran de Libreosteo